Ben Rosenblatt – Senior Rehabilitation Scientist
I am currently the Senior Rehabilitation Scientist for the Intensive Rehab Unit of the British Olympic Medical Institute and English Institute of Sport. The purpose of the unit is to accelerate rehabilitation and my role is to provide bespoke strength and conditioning programmes for complicated injuries and provide objective measures of an athlete’s progression through rehabilitation. I also provide consultancy services and coaching support to national governing bodies and Olympic and professional athletes. Prior to this role I have was the Head of Science and Conditioning at a Premier League football club and have coached collegiate athletes in the USA. I am also currently undertaking a PhD in the biomechanical aspects of specificity in strength training. My coaching philosophy is to create an environment for an athlete or team to develop and excel by providing needs based support and coaching to the athlete, team, coach and their support team.
